-
According to the actual needs of the project, consider the cost and power consumption, as well as the interface of the module. You can refer to the development board of Guangzhou Stowe.
-
Now the most used should still be Samsung's S3C2440, there is a lot of information, many routines, and resources should be enough.
-
Usage, power consumption, whether to use an operating system, which interfaces need to be integrated, etc.
-
Quality, Brand, Use, Price, etc.
-
According to your own understanding, talk about how to choose the type and series of ARM microprocessors in practical applications?
Dear --- In view of the many advantages of ARM microprocessors, with the gradual development of embedded applications at home and abroad, ARM microprocessors are bound to receive extensive attention and applications. However, because ARM microprocessors have as many as a dozen core structures, 10 chip manufacturers, and ever-changing internal function configuration combinations, it is very difficult for developers to choose solutions, so it is very important to do some comparative research on ARM chips.
-
The purpose of this blog is to sort out some concepts about ARM and ARM chips, such as what S3C2440 is, and what is its relationship with ARM.
ARM mainly designs the ARM series AISC processor cores, which do not produce chips, but only provide IP cores. Let's start with an example to explain the architecture, cores, processors, and chips: the S3C2440, which is an SoC chip.
Note that it is not a CPU, 2440 is a bit similar to the 51 microcontroller we are familiar with, both belong to the embedded. The development of embedded has gone through three stages, namely SCM, MCU, SCM or MCU, and 2440 belongs to SOC. Below is the internal structure of 2440.
The arm920t in the middle is the 2440 processor, and the processor and core are a concept here in my opinion, but one is a hard concept and the other is a soft concept. The 920T here is both a processor and a core. And what Samsung does is something other than this CPU.
That is to say, Arm gave Samsung ARM920T, and Samsung designed the S3C2440 chip based on this processor.
Now let's talk about the ARM architecture, the architecture is actually a design idea, based on which the ARM company has designed different processors, please see this table below.
So we can see that the architecture of S3C2440 is armv4.
For example, the S3C2440 is based on the ARM920T core.
To sum up: a single rack-acre base corresponds to multiple cores, and a single core corresponds to multiple chips, and Arm provides cores to chip manufacturers, such as Samsung.
-
5.What are the series of ArmCortex processors and what are their characteristics?
Hello, I am a teacher who is good at Chinese studies, literature and history, military, social, emotional, family, communication, digital and other aspects of problem analysis. I'm glad to serve you in the state! After the classic processor ARM11, ARM's products were renamed Cortex and divided into three categories: A, R and M, aiming to serve a variety of different markets; To put it simply, Cortex is the name of a series of processors from Arm.
For example, Intel's processors include Core, Pentium, and Celeron. ARM was named with numbers in the initial processor models, the last one was the ARM11 series, and after the application of the ARMV7 architecture, the Cortex series was launched, and the old ones were named the Classic series; [Features]: High performance]:
Fast processing power combined with high clock frequency; Real-time]: The processing power meets the hard real-time limit in all field song rounds; Secure]: A reliable and trustworthy system with high fault tolerance; Affordable]:
Features for optimal performance, power consumption, and area; The ARM Cortex-M processor family is a family of upward-compatible, energy-efficient, easy-to-use processors designed to help developers meet the needs of tomorrow's embedded applications. These needs include more functionality at a lower cost, increasing connectivity, improving reuse, and increasing energy efficiency; The Cortex-M series is optimized for cost- and power-sensitive MCUs and mixed-signal devices for end-use applications such as smart measurement, human-machine interface devices, automotive and industrial control systems, large home appliances, consumer products, and medical devices;
-
Answer] Compared with other processor cores, the main features of the :d ARM core are: power consumption, strong function, low cost, etc
16-bit THUMB coexists with 32-bit ARM and THUMB-2 dual command silver destruction set, and has a very large number of partners, which has a wide range of applications. Due to the RISC architecture, ARM has technical features such as single co-mode cycle operation, loading storage instructions to access memory, and instruction pipeline technology. Therefore, D is selected for this question.
-
Answer]: A big-end mode means that the high bit of the data is stored in the low address of the memory, and the low bit of the data is stored in the high address of the memory; The small-endian mode Bishanyou means that the master of the data is stored in the high address of the memory, and the low bit of the data is saved in the low address of the memory; The ARM processor supports THUMB (16-bit) and ARM (32-bit) dual instruction sets, which can be well compatible with 8-bit and 16-bit devices; The MPU is the memory protection unit of the ARM processor, and the MMU is the memory management unit of the ARM processor. Therefore, A is selected for this question.
-
Answer]: AMMU is the abbreviation of memory management unit, the Chinese name is memory management single Xianfeng Huaiyuan, which is used to manage virtual memory, physical memory brother and friend control line, but also responsible for virtual address mapping to physical address, and provide hardware mechanism memory access authorization. Therefore, options B and C are incorrect.
The nested vector interrupt controller abbreviation is NVIC, and the D option is rotten wrong. Therefore, A is selected for this question.
The number of bits in a microprocessor chip refers to the number of words that a machine's periodic clock pulse can process. >>>More
2800+Frequency modulation is not adjusted to 1900+,The key reason for the white screen is that the power supply voltage of the motherboard is unstable caused by capacitor damage,Your problem can generally be solved after the merchant has replaced the capacitor for you!!
For example, a strong man represents a single-core processor, a person can pick 30 pounds of water, and there are two small wrestlers, each person can only pick 25 pounds of water, now there are 100 pounds of water, and strong men need to use four times to pick up, and two small wrestlers only need to work twice at the same time. >>>More
With 65nm technology, lower power consumption and better performance! The dual-core core uses a shared second-level cache, which is better than that of PD, PD does not have a core and a second-level cache, and the data between the two cores needs to pass through the north-south bridge, while the core uses a shared second-level cache, and the data transmission is faster!
1.Take a look at the CPU usage in the task manager while playing games. If it's 100%, see which process it is. If it's another process, see if it's a virus ...... >>>More